PHL Festive Decor Brings Christmas Cheer, Brightens Holiday Season at Ritz-Carlton Hotel Bahrain
The holiday season in Bahrain was ushered in with a Christmas lighting ceremony at the grand Ritz-Carlton Hotel on December 02, featuring festive décor from the Philippines. The ceremony was held at the Hotel’s sprawling grounds with over 700 people attending. Clockwise from top left: the Ritz-Carlton employees choir composed of the hotel’s Filipino personnel who sang carols in front of the grand Christmas tree decked with angels and wreaths made of sinamay, dried natural leaves, berries and fruits from Baguio City; Top right: Ambassador Alfonso and Mrs. Caroline Ver at the hotel lobby decorated with Christmas trees and accents made of capiz shells, mother of pearl, crystal beads and natural material ornaments from Cebu; Bottom left: The Lobby and Atrium ceiling are strewn with parols from Cebu; and bottom right: the “Floating Garden” centerpiece at the hotel’s entrance, driveway and rotunda is made of Silk Wisteria and Silk Hydrangea flowers from Baguio City. The supply, design and execution of the decorations were made by Filipina Felma Bacalso-Taylor, Managing Director of Bahrain-based Designer Imports WLL, an import-export and interior design company (www.designer-imports.biz). Ms. Taylor regularly supplies Philippine furniture and handicraft items to several Bahrain hotels, homes and offices. (Photos courtesy of Felma Taylor & Ritz Carlton Hotel Bahrain)
